Rigetti Computing’s stock is experiencing an upward trend following news that the U.S. government is contemplating investments in quantum computing firms. While the U.S. Department of Commerce has denied any active negotiations, the WSJ reported that a Rigetti representative confirmed the engagement with the government regarding funding. This possible federal investment serves as the primary catalyst: it’s not just theoretical policy, but a significant near-term driver for the stock.

Why Government Investment Transforms the Risk Profile
If the U.S. government engages in investment, it achieves three key outcomes that immediately alter the investment narrative:
- Validation and De-risking: Government involvement distinguishes serious contenders like Rigetti and D-Wave, who are in competition with industry leaders such as IBM, from the speculative “noise.” This validation indicates that the technology is legitimate, the applications are significant, and the timeline for commercialization is shortening. For institutional investors who previously viewed quantum as “too early,” this substantially mitigates existential risk.
- Unlocks Institutional Capital: At present, quantum stocks are primarily driven by retail trading. Government endorsement provides the essential institutional support, attracting large investments from pension and hedge funds. This institutional purchasing generates sustained momentum that outlasts transient retail surges.
- Accelerates Strategic Revenue: Rigetti’s superconducting processors are crucial for national security initiatives such as cryptography and complex optimization. Federal contracts or classified programs deliver reliable, high-value revenue streams, alongside a technical endorsement from the most discerning customer.
The Mechanism of Stock Appreciation
Government backing tackles the critical vulnerabilities of small quantum firms:
- Improved Access to Capital: Investment (or the prospect of it) transforms the funding landscape. Rigetti can secure future funding at more favorable valuations, lengthening its operational runway and avoiding shareholder-diluting financings. This alleviates a significant stock overhang.
- Strengthened Competitive Position: In a competitive landscape (IBM, Google, Honeywell), government endorsement indicates that Rigetti’s technology is considered strategically vital. This designation draws commercial clients eager to partner with federally-backed platforms, fostering a powerful virtuous cycle of validation and growth.

There Are Risks
Let it be clear: this continues to be a speculative venture. The mainstream commercial viability of quantum computing is still years away. The technology might encounter unforeseen obstacles. Rivals could outpace Rigetti’s methods. The revenue might not occur as swiftly as proponents anticipate.
